Healthy Sleep Habits Call-In (4 1/2 week old)"I currently have a 4 ½ week old daughter Ella. Like most new parents we had many unanswered questions regarding healthy sleeping habits and many general questions regarding her overall well being. Ella had also developed reflux and had begun having difficulty and crying a lot when I was feeding her with a bottle. She was being breastfed and bottle fed. One of my friends sent me an email about Rebecca’s call in sessions regarding healthy sleeping habits. We called her to sign up for the session and she was immediately very helpful and asked me a bunch of questions regarding Ella’s sleeping, eating and reflux symptoms. Within a few hours she had sent me an email summarizing all of the points we discussed about Ella as well as attachments to sleep and feeding schedules. She called me the following day for the phone call in and spent almost an hour with me going over healthy sleep habits and general pointers. Rebecca told me that even though it is too early to start formal sleep training; it is not too early to start healthy sleep habits. The schedules she provides are meant to be guides which will take you from a newborn to three years of age and will alter and change as your child develops. Even though the call in was geared towards healthy sleeping habits Rebecca was able to offer other extremely helpful tips and advice on general parenting issues and she gave me some good pointers on how to deal with a reflux baby. Like most new parents who have a crying baby I kept wondering what I was doing wrong. Rebecca was very reassuring in letting me know that this is normal and that unfortunately with or without reflux sometimes there is nothing that can be done but to hold her and try to console her. We are all looking forward to working more with Rebecca."-Michelle M., Long Island, NY, 2/25/2013
